O'Farrell near Stockton
wnp37.01242

O'Farrell near Stockton

1906 Earthquake and Fire, View east toward Market Street and the Call Building. Ruins and rubble after the earthquake. Ruins of Alcazar Theater, 116 O'Farrell, and Delmonico Restaurant, 110 O'Farrell, on left, Orpheum Theater, 119 O'Farrell, on right. In distance, Call Building, Call Building Annex, Kamm Building on Market Street. [Call Bldg, Looking down O'Farrell St.] Same image as 27.0130 with different cropping.

South Van Ness near 21st
wnp37.01245

South Van Ness near 21st

1906 Earthquake and Fire, Collapsed Home of Julius E. Peters, 2522 Howard (now South Van Ness), west side, near 21st Street. Neighboring house to left has Red Cross sign on pillar and still stands at 1060 South Van Ness. Stove in street. Front yard with palms.
